A Buick Rainier Pushrod plays a crucial role in improving engine reliability together with performance features in Buick Rainier vehicles. The Buick Rainier engine depends on this crucial Pushrod component because it enables the exact control of intake and exhaust valve operations required for effective combustion. The overhead valve (OHV) engines in Buick Rainier models function efficiently through the Pushrod mechanism which carries camshaft motion to the valve lifter and rocker arm for valve control. Engine performance issues become serious when you do not keep the proper clearance of the Pushrod because bent Pushrods create significant problems. The safety and operational efficiency of the engine valvetrain system mainly depends on regular inspection with timely replacement of damaged Pushrods.
